In 2026, Carrick Hill marks 40 years as a historic house museum, artgallery, and garden.

Officially opened in March 1986 by Queen Elizabeth II andPrince Philip, the estate has since welcomed generations of visitors to exploreits remarkable collections and grounds.

Out of the Archive brings rarely seen objects andartworks into view, including fragile pieces, unusual items, and works withcomplex or sensitive histories. Drawn largely from the Haywards’ 1983 bequest,alongside later donations, this exhibition celebrates the depth of thecollection and the enduring legacy of Sir Edward and Lady Ursula Hayward.

February 18 – 29 March 2026

The Wall Gallery, Carrick Hill House Museum
